V. Credé is a scholar working on Nuclear and High Energy Physics, Atomic and Molecular Physics, and Optics and Biomedical Engineering. According to data from OpenAlex, V. Credé has authored 71 papers receiving a total of 459 indexed citations (citations by other indexed papers that have themselves been cited), including 67 papers in Nuclear and High Energy Physics, 19 papers in Atomic and Molecular Physics, and Optics and 9 papers in Biomedical Engineering. Recurrent topics in V. Credé’s work include Quantum Chromodynamics and Particle Interactions (59 papers), Particle physics theoretical and experimental studies (50 papers) and High-Energy Particle Collisions Research (31 papers). V. Credé is often cited by papers focused on Quantum Chromodynamics and Particle Interactions (59 papers), Particle physics theoretical and experimental studies (50 papers) and High-Energy Particle Collisions Research (31 papers). V. Credé collaborates with scholars based in United States, Germany and Spain. V. Credé's co-authors include P. Eugenio, A. Ostrovidov, Valery E. Lyubovitskij, Thomas Gutsche and J. Vijande and has published in prestigious journals such as Physics Letters B, Reports on Progress in Physics and Progress in Particle and Nuclear Physics.
